Shakira Says People Just Watched When She Was Attacked by Wild Boars

The 'Hips Don't Lie' hitmaker recalls the 'crazy' boar ambush, claiming onlookers just watched when she was screaming for help during the wild animal attack.

AceShowbiz - Shakira has shared more details of a "crazy" incident in September (21) when wild boars snatched her handbag.

The singer was relaxing in a Barcelona park with her son when they were ambushed by two large hogs - and, according to the "Gypsy" singer, onlookers "weren't doing anything" to help them out.

"I was taking my son, Milan, for a walk in the park and I got him a little ice cream," she told Glamour UK. "We sat on one of those park benches and we were just minding our own business. And then two huge wild boars came from the back and ambushed (us) and took my purse!"

"And I was like, 'Oh, my God! Oh, my God!' and screaming, because they were taking it away, with my phone in it, my car keys, everything! Like they could understand me! And people were just watching and they weren't doing anything!"

She added, "They started digging inside my purse…obviously my son's sandwich was inside the purse, so that's why they were so interested. So they took the sandwich and walked away and left my purse. It was wild."

Shakira previously opened up about the encounter on her Instagram Story, sharing with fans: Look at how two wild boar which attacked me in the park have left my bag.

"They were taking my bag to the woods with my mobile phone in it. They've destroyed everything. Milan, tell the truth. Say how your mummy stood up to the wild boar."

Boars are becoming a huge problem in Barcelona, with police receiving calls about them attacking dogs and running into cars in recent years.
